Understanding the Essentials of Cholesterol Testing
Cholesterol testing plays a critical role in monitoring cardiovascular health. It evaluates the levels of different types of cholesterol and fats in your bloodstream. This helps doctors determine your risk for heart disease, stroke, and other related conditions. The test typically measures four key components: low-density lipoprotein (LDL), high-density lipoprotein (HDL), total cholesterol, and triglycerides.
LDL is often called “bad” cholesterol because high levels can lead to plaque buildup in arteries. HDL is known as “good” cholesterol since it helps remove LDL from your bloodstream. Total cholesterol sums up all the cholesterol types in your blood. Triglycerides are another type of fat that can increase your risk if elevated.
Knowing these numbers provides a snapshot of your heart’s health and guides necessary lifestyle changes or treatments. The test itself is straightforward but requires some preparation for accurate results.
Preparing for Your Cholesterol Test
Proper preparation ensures the accuracy of your cholesterol test results. Most labs recommend fasting for 9 to 12 hours before the blood draw. Fasting means no food or drinks except water during this period. Eating before the test can temporarily raise triglyceride levels, skewing results.
Hydration is important; drinking water helps keep veins accessible and makes drawing blood easier. Avoid alcohol for at least 24 hours before testing since it affects triglycerides and liver function.
Certain medications and supplements might influence cholesterol readings as well. Inform your healthcare provider about any prescriptions or over-the-counter products you are taking. They will advise whether you should pause them before testing.
Scheduling the test early in the day can be more convenient when fasting overnight. Follow any specific instructions provided by your healthcare professional or lab technician closely.
The Blood Draw Process Explained
The actual procedure for how to test your cholesterol is simple and quick. A healthcare professional will draw a small amount of blood from a vein, usually in your arm near the elbow crease. The area is cleaned with an antiseptic wipe first to reduce infection risk.
A tourniquet may be applied above the puncture site to make veins more prominent and easier to access. Once blood is drawn into tubes, pressure is applied to stop bleeding, followed by a bandage.
The entire process typically takes just a few minutes and causes minimal discomfort—often described as a quick pinch or sting. If you feel uneasy about needles or blood draws, let the technician know; they can help ease anxiety with calming techniques or distractions.
After collection, samples are sent to a laboratory where advanced instruments analyze lipid profiles accurately within hours or days depending on the facility.
Interpreting Cholesterol Test Results
Once your results arrive, understanding what they mean can empower you to make informed health decisions. Each component has recommended target ranges based on current clinical guidelines:
| Cholesterol Type | Optimal Range (mg/dL) | Health Implications |
|---|---|---|
| Total Cholesterol | Less than 200 | Lower values reduce heart disease risk. |
| LDL (“Bad” Cholesterol) | Less than 100 (optimal) | High levels increase artery plaque buildup. |
| HDL (“Good” Cholesterol) | 40 or higher (men), 50 or higher (women) | Higher values protect against heart disease. |
| Triglycerides | Less than 150 | Elevated levels raise cardiovascular risk. |
If total cholesterol exceeds 240 mg/dL or LDL rises above 160 mg/dL, doctors may consider it high risk needing intervention. Low HDL below recommended levels also signals increased danger even if other numbers seem okay.
Triglyceride levels over 200 mg/dL often require lifestyle adjustments such as diet changes and increased exercise due to their link with metabolic syndrome and diabetes risk.
Doctors combine these values with other factors like age, smoking status, blood pressure, and family history to assess overall cardiovascular risk and decide on treatment plans.

Diverse Methods: How To Test Your Cholesterol Beyond Standard Blood Draws
While traditional fasting blood tests remain most common for checking cholesterol levels, alternative methods have emerged:
1. Non-Fasting Lipid Panels
Some labs now accept non-fasting samples since research shows minimal impact on LDL and HDL values in many people. This convenience encourages more frequent screening but may slightly affect triglyceride accuracy.
2. Home Testing Kits
Home kits allow individuals to collect small finger-prick blood samples themselves using lancets included in kits mailed directly to consumers or purchased at pharmacies. Samples are then sent back to labs for analysis or processed by portable devices providing immediate results.
Though convenient, home tests vary in precision compared to clinical laboratory standards and should not replace regular medical checkups but serve as supplementary tools for monitoring trends over time.
3. Advanced Lipoprotein Testing
Beyond standard lipid profiles, some specialized tests measure particle size and density of LDL molecules (small dense LDL being more harmful) or lipoprotein(a) concentrations linked with genetic risks not captured by routine panels.
These advanced tests require specific ordering by physicians based on patient history or unclear standard results but offer deeper insights into cardiovascular risks when warranted.
